EA’s Battlefield: Bad Company is now playable on Xbox One via the backwards compatibility program.

Battlefield: Bad Company came out in 2008 to a decent reception, and received praise for the introduction of highly destructible environments. For the first time you could completely level a building and destroy the cover of your enemies thanks to the newly introduced Frostbite engine. Wow. Frostbite being a new engine. Oh, 2008.

Battlefield: Bad Company is now the third game from the EA shooters franchise to the backward compatibility program, following on from Battlefield 3 (you’ll still need your disc though) and the excellent Battlefield Bad Company 2.
